Trail Overview

This is an easy 50" trail through the Gunnison National Forest. The south end starts off of the Razor Creek ATV trail through wide open sagebrush valleys next to a beautiful grove of aspens. There are some water and mud puddles on the trail in the beginning, and it starts climbing up the hillside. The trail is pretty smooth and wide, with only a bit of loose rock, but has a bunch of big rollers that you need to check up for when you enter the trees. It has some tight turns through the pine trees, which very closely line the trail, and goes through a gate. After the first mile, it starts to steeply descend through the pines and gets a bit more rutted out at the bottom of the descent. The north end ends in another beautiful meadow surrounded by aspens. Overall it's a pretty easy trail and a fun ride through some beautiful mountain terrain.
